OpenAI acquires Ona to embed secure workspaces for autonomous AI agents

OpenAI announced it will acquire Ona, a 79‑person cloud development environment provider, to embed secure, persistent workspaces for autonomous AI agents. Ona’s platform reported a 13‑fold rise in weekly agent sessions across banks, pharma firms, and sovereign wealth funds. Analysts estimate the deal could be valued between $450 million and $500 million.

SoundHound AI to Acquire LivePerson for $43M, Creating $250M Enterprise AI Platform
NewsApr 23, 2026

SoundHound AI to Acquire LivePerson for $43M, Creating $250M Enterprise AI Platform

SoundHound AI announced a $43 million cash acquisition of LivePerson, lifting the combined enterprise value to $250 million. The deal merges SoundHound’s voice‑AI engine with LivePerson’s digital messaging platform, targeting a $350‑$400 million revenue run‑rate by 2027.

ServiceNow Posts $3.67 B Q1 Subscription Revenue, 22% YoY Growth
NewsApr 23, 2026

ServiceNow Posts $3.67 B Q1 Subscription Revenue, 22% YoY Growth

ServiceNow announced first‑quarter 2026 subscription revenue of $3.671 billion, a 22% year‑over‑year increase that topped the high end of its guidance. The company also highlighted a surge in large contracts, a $12.64 billion cRPO balance and the early close of its Armis...
